The rover was designed to complete the tasks laid out in the 2019 Mar’s Society University Rover Challenge (URC) competition rules.
- Science mission- The rover must conduct an in-situ analysis to determine the presence of life, either extinct or extant, at designated sights.
- Extreme retrieval and delivery- The rover must pick up and deliver objects in the field while traversing a wide variety of terrain no further than 1 km.
- Equipment servicing- The rover must perform operations on an equipment system after traveling up to 0.25 km.
- Autonomous traversal mission- The rover must autonomously traverse between markers across moderately difficult terrain up to a total distance of 2 km.
